The United Arab Emirates (UAE) is a modern Arabian Gulf nation renowned for its opulent cities, luxurious lifestyle, and ambitious development projects. A federation of seven emirates, the UAE has transformed itself from a desert landscape into a global business and tourism hub. Its economy, primarily driven by oil and gas, has diversified into sectors like finance, real estate, and aviation. While deeply rooted in Islamic traditions, the UAE embraces a cosmopolitan culture, welcoming people from all over the world. This unique blend of tradition and modernity defines the UAE’s distinctive character.

Official Languages: Arabic

Currency: The United Arab Emirates Dirham (AED)

Time zone: GST (Gulf Standard Time) (UTC+4)
